Divergent consequences of PSEN1 knockout and PSEN2 knockout in stem cell derived models of the brain

2026-04-13

Abstract excerpt

γ-secretase is a multi-subunit enzyme complex responsible for cleaving hundreds of substrates in diverse cellular contexts. Variation in subunit composition - including the use of alternate catalytic subunits Presenilin 1 (PSEN1) and Presenilin 2 (PSEN2) - results in diverse γ-secretase complexes.
